86 fputs(_("Preallocate space to, or deallocate space from a file.\n"), out
);
88 fputs(USAGE_OPTIONS
, out
);
89 fputs(_(" -c, --collapse-range remove a range from the file\n"), out
);
90 fputs(_(" -d, --dig-holes detect zeroes and replace with holes\n"), out
);
91 fputs(_(" -i, --insert-range insert a hole at range, shifting existing data\n"), out
);
92 fputs(_(" -l, --length <num> length for range operations, in bytes\n"), out
);
93 fputs(_(" -n, --keep-size maintain the apparent size of the file\n"), out
);
94 fputs(_(" -o, --offset <num> offset for range operations, in bytes\n"), out
);
95 fputs(_(" -p, --punch-hole replace a range with a hole (implies -n)\n"), out
);
96 fputs(_(" -z, --zero-range zero and ensure allocation of a range\n"), out
);
97 #ifdef HAVE_POSIX_FALLOCATE
98 fputs(_(" -x, --posix use posix_fallocate(3) instead of fallocate(2)\n"), out
);
100 fputs(_(" -v, --verbose verbose mode\n"), out
);
